The Property Manager manages and operates efficiently and economically the clients assets and finances with the highest level of integrity and excellence. He/She assures strict compliance with the Management Agreement between ProExcel Property Managers Inc. and the specific assigned property including but not limited to Master Deed & Declaration of Restrictions Implementing House Rules & Regulations and ByLaws. He/She enforces the Policy Guidelines of the Company and the Client as promulgated by the Board of Trustees.
DESCRIPTION OF FUNCTIONS
KEY ACCOUNTABILITY
1: ADMINISTRATION
1. Coordinate with different organizations agencies and/or offices in relation to the assigned property.
2. Supervise all personnel assigned in the specific property including those from other subcontracted services such as but not limited to housekeeping grounds keeping engineering maintenance and security.
3. Attend and supervise general maintenance requirements security and safety control and cleanliness of the assigned property.
4. Address and respond to residents concerns complaints and inquiries.
5. Act as mediator on issues between residents before elevating the issue to the Grievance Committee head.
6. Prepare and submit monthly management reports and/or other reports as required by the management direct superior or division head.
7. Insure and keep insured on behalf of the client the assigned property against loss or damage by fire and other risks or perils as deemed necessary and as approved by the Condominium Corporation or Homeowners Association.
8. Recommended programs and/or action plan to maintain and improve all facilities and services in the assigned property.
9. Prepare meeting agenda and materials for the Board Meetings General Membership meetings and other special meetings.
10. Implement policies and programs as promulgated by the Board of Trustees.
11. Prepares correspondences circulars Quarterly Newsletters memoranda and the like for the information of Unit Owners Tenants and/or Occupants reviewed and duly approved by QA department immediate heads Board of Trustees and PD/Marketing as applicable.
12. Ensure that all construction and fitout works are compliant to the building code and LGU regulations.
13. Conduct monthly Board of Trustees meetings Annual General Membership Meeting (AGMM) monthly vendors evaluation weekly toolbox and coordination meetings.
14. Ensures all legal/conveyance documents are properly filed and available on site such as but not limited to asbuilt plans permits and licenses minutes of the meetings financial records and other pertinent documents.
15. Safeguard residents security and confidentiality standards specifically on data handling.
